Anticipation is building among fans of Nigeria’s biggest reality television show as organisers of Big Brother Naija officially announced the commencement of auditions for the highly anticipated Season 11 edition.
MultiChoice Nigeria revealed that aspiring contestants can begin online registration ahead of the physical audition phase scheduled to start on May 22. The organisers disclosed that interested applicants must first complete the digital application process before being shortlisted for in-person screenings.
According to the audition guidelines, participation is strictly reserved for Nigerians aged 21 and above who possess valid identification documents. The audition exercise remains free of charge, continuing the show’s long-standing policy against paid entries.
Selected applicants will receive email notifications containing details of their audition venues and schedules after successfully completing the registration stage.
This year’s physical auditions are expected to take place between May 22 and May 24 in Lagos, Abuja and Enugu, as producers search for a new crop of housemates capable of delivering another memorable season filled with drama, entertainment and viral moments.
Prospective contestants have been advised to apply through the official Africa Magic BBNaija portal before the registration window closes. Organisers also warned that available slots are limited and applications could shut earlier than expected once capacity is reached.
